The fire is dangerous and fast-spreading, fire officials say – Strong winds are blowing in the area with gusts of up to 100 km per hour – Firefighting forces are constantly increasing – Roads are closed
In full progress is the large fire that broke out shortly before 15.00, in a forest area in Katsimidi of Parnitha, near a tavern.
According to the official information from the Fire Department, strong ground forces are fighting the flames and will be further reinforced with 100 firefighters and 30 vehicles from Thessaly, Epirus and Central Macedonia. From the air, 12 aerial vehicles, 4 aircraft and 8 helicopters operate.
Wind gusts exceed 100 km per hour
In the area of ​​the fire in Parnitha, the speed of the winds reaches 50 kilometers, with gusts exceeding 100 kilometers per hour. These conditions and the fact that there are high voltage pylons in the area make it difficult for aerial vehicles to operate. For this reason they mainly operate helicopters.
Assistance in the extinguishing work is provided by strong forces, from volunteer firefighters, a number of volunteer firefighting vehicles as well as water tankers and work machines of the Region of Attica and of the General Staff of National Defense.
